Gravel biking around Habach offers routes through the scenic Alpine foothills of Bavaria, Germany. The region is characterized by rolling hills, valleys, and a mix of forest tracks and unpaved roads, providing diverse terrain for gravel cyclists. Situated between Munich and Garmisch-Partenkirchen, Habach's surroundings include natural features like the "Blue Land" region, suggesting picturesque routes away from heavy traffic. This landscape provides varied topography suitable for different levels of gravel biking.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many traffic-free gravel bike trails are available around Habach?

There are over 90 traffic-free gravel bike trails around Habach, offering a wide range of options for all skill levels. You'll find everything from easy, short loops to more challenging, longer routes through the scenic Bavarian landscape.

What kind of terrain can I expect on gravel bike trails near Habach?

The region around Habach is nestled in the Alpine foothills, so you can expect a varied topography. Trails often feature a mix of rolling hills, gentle ascents and descents, and picturesque valleys. You'll ride on unpaved roads, forest tracks, and quiet secondary roads, providing a diverse and engaging gravel biking experience.

Are there easy, beginner-friendly gravel bike routes in Habach?

Yes, Habach offers several easy gravel bike routes perfect for beginners or those looking for a relaxed ride. An excellent option is the View of Großer Ostersee – Great Oster Lake loop from Iffeldorf, which is just over 10 km long with minimal elevation gain, making it very accessible.

Can I find longer, more challenging traffic-free gravel routes around Habach?

Absolutely. For those seeking a longer and more challenging ride, consider the Murnau Moor – View of Riegsee loop from Riegsee. This route spans over 42 km and includes more significant elevation changes, offering a rewarding experience for advanced gravel bikers.

Are there any circular gravel bike routes around Habach?

Many of the traffic-free gravel routes around Habach are designed as circular loops, allowing you to start and end at the same point. For example, the View of Großer Ostersee – View of the Osterseen loop from Iffeldorf is a popular circular route that takes you through beautiful natural landscapes.

What scenic viewpoints or natural features can I discover on these trails?

The trails often lead through the stunning 'Blue Land' region, offering serene and picturesque views. You can expect panoramic vistas of the Alpine foothills, tranquil lakes like the Großer Ostersee, and lush forests. Keep an eye out for highlights such as the Sonnenspitz summit with views over Lake Kochel or the View of Kochelsee and Herzogstand, which are accessible from nearby areas.

Are there waterfalls accessible from the gravel bike routes?

While not directly on every gravel route, the Habach area is close to several beautiful waterfalls. You can explore highlights like the Lainbach Waterfall or the At the Kesselbach Falls. These can be great detours or destinations for a combined biking and hiking trip.

Are there family-friendly traffic-free gravel bike trails suitable for children?

Yes, several routes are suitable for families. The easier, shorter loops with minimal elevation, such as the Great Oster Lake loop from Iffeldorf, are ideal for families with children, offering safe and enjoyable rides away from traffic.
